网络全流量采集分析系统如何实现高效数据收集?
随着互联网的飞速发展,网络全流量采集分析系统在各个行业中的应用越来越广泛。它能够帮助企业实时了解网络状况,优化网络架构,提高网络运行效率。然而,高效的数据收集是网络全流量采集分析系统的核心,那么,如何实现高效数据收集呢?本文将为您详细解析。
一、选择合适的网络全流量采集设备
网络全流量采集分析系统的数据收集依赖于网络全流量采集设备。在选择设备时,需要考虑以下几个方面:
高带宽处理能力:网络全流量采集设备应具备高带宽处理能力,以适应日益增长的流量需求。
高性能的硬件配置:高性能的硬件配置能够确保设备稳定运行,提高数据采集效率。
强大的数据处理能力:强大的数据处理能力可以保证数据在采集、传输、存储等环节的高效处理。
兼容性:设备应具备良好的兼容性,能够与各种网络环境、协议和应用兼容。
二、优化网络架构
网络架构的优化对于网络全流量采集分析系统的数据收集至关重要。以下是一些优化网络架构的方法:
分层设计:采用分层设计,将网络划分为核心层、汇聚层和接入层,降低网络复杂度,提高数据采集效率。
冗余设计:通过冗余设计,确保网络在出现故障时能够快速切换,降低数据采集中断的风险。
合理规划IP地址:合理规划IP地址,避免地址冲突,提高数据采集的准确性。
优化路由策略:优化路由策略,降低数据传输延迟,提高数据采集效率。
三、采用高效的数据采集技术
深度包检测(DPDK)技术:DPDK技术能够提高数据包处理速度,降低延迟,适用于高速网络环境。
硬件加速:利用硬件加速技术,如GPU、FPGA等,提高数据采集和处理效率。
数据压缩:在保证数据完整性的前提下,采用数据压缩技术,降低数据传输带宽需求。
四、建立完善的数据存储和备份机制
分布式存储:采用分布式存储技术,提高数据存储的可靠性和扩展性。
数据备份:定期对数据进行备份,确保数据安全。
数据清理:定期清理过期数据,提高数据存储空间利用率。
五、案例分析
以某大型企业为例,该企业采用网络全流量采集分析系统,通过以上方法实现了高效数据收集。在优化网络架构后,网络带宽利用率提高了30%,数据采集效率提升了40%。同时,通过采用DPDK技术和硬件加速,数据包处理速度提高了50%,有效降低了延迟。
总结
网络全流量采集分析系统的高效数据收集,需要从设备选择、网络架构优化、数据采集技术、数据存储和备份等多个方面进行综合考虑。通过以上方法,企业可以实现对网络流量的全面监控和分析,为优化网络架构、提高网络运行效率提供有力支持。
猜你喜欢:Prometheus